Innovation Summits

GLI Cohorts convene in person for weeklong Innovation Summits, integrating faculty-led instruction with hands-on learning in diverse communities. Summits provide an immersive growth environment where Cohort Members master Design Thinking methodologies in collaboration with local organizational partners.

Innovation Summits

The Global Arts MBA Cohort participates in three in-person Innovation Summits — Spain, Patagonia, and Colombia. Supported by international faculty and mentors of world-class institutions, from Harvard University Business School and Rochester University to the EY Business Academy, GLI Fellows collaborate with local entrepreneurs across the selected communities and surrounding counties to support local impact-oriented businesses.

Special Exemption for Career Artists

The Global Arts MBA recognizes that across the sector, many of the highest-level career creatives (music prodigies, professional dancers, and others) have pursued their craft from a young age and therefore may not possess a conventional academic background.

The Admissions Committee acknowledges these exceptional career experiences where relevant as serving in place of the bachelor’s degree otherwise required for admission to The Global Arts MBA.

Candidates with this profile should slect "Other" for Highest Academic Degree.
